Default Computer problem maybe??

I am currently deployed to Iraq as we speak and my wife is back home with my 99 C5. She is trying to take care of it but for some reason the service engine soon keeps coming on and the check engine light. And all the gauges are reading all the way to the right. Im not sure if this is a common problem amoung the 99's or what? I cant really do anything myself over here. BUt if anyone could fill me in on some info of what to do. I just had to have a friend replace the oil sending unit last week since I am still over here.

Stingray,

Have the battery checked and if that turns out OK, then have the BCM checked (it tends to get wet and cause all kinds of problems). Good luck with the repair and get home safe.
